Richard Rahul Verma, who quietly played a key role in the Congressional passage of the civil nuclear deal and a strong advocate of deepening Indo-US ties, has been sworn in as the US Ambassador to New Delhi, becoming the first ever Indian-American to hold the post.

NEW YORK: A federal appeals court dismissed a 1984-Sikhrights- violation case filed against the Congress by a rights group, saying the case did not sufficiently “touch and concern” the United States.
